What we know about the measurement:

KEF Q250 is a passive center that cost around 600 USD

  • Quality of the measurement data is high.
  • Origin of the data is ErinsAudioCorner.
  • Format of the data is generated by a Klippel NFS .
  • -3dB (resp. -6db) point v.s. reference is at 90.8Hz (resp. 63.0Hz).
  • Reference level is normalised to -0.2dB computed over the frequency range [300.0Hz, 5000.0Hz].
  • Frequency deviation is 3.0dB over the same frequency range.
  • Directivity
    • Horizontal directivity is (-50.0°, 40.0°) between 1kHz and 10kHz. Angle computed for +/-6dB.
    • Vertical directivity is (-50.0°, 40.0°) between 1kHz and 10kHz. Angle computed for +/-6dB.
  • Tonality (Preference) Score
    • Tonality (Preference) Score is 4.21 and would be 6.96 with a perfect subwoofer.
      • Details: NBD: ON 0.468, LW 0.391, SP 0.386, PIR 0.356; SM: SP0.841, PIR0.651; LFQ 0.948, LFX 62Hz
    • Tonality (Preference) Score is 5.44 with an EQ and would be 8.05 with a perfect subwoofer and the same EQ.
      • Details: NBD: ON 0.385, LW 0.309, SP 0.289, PIR 0.258; SM: SP0.96, PIR0.908; LFQ 0.948, LFX 58Hz
